excel如何快速算出年齡精確到日 Excel計算年齡
在使用Excel進行數據分析和計算時,經常會遇到需要計算年齡的情況。通過Excel的日期函數,我們可以輕松地計算出一個人的年齡,而且還能精確到日。在Excel中,日期被表示為一個數字,其中整數部分代表
在使用Excel進行數據分析和計算時,經常會遇到需要計算年齡的情況。通過Excel的日期函數,我們可以輕松地計算出一個人的年齡,而且還能精確到日。
在Excel中,日期被表示為一個數字,其中整數部分代表日期,小數部分代表時間。要計算年齡,我們可以利用日期函數DATEDIF和TODAY來實現。首先,我們需要在Excel中輸入一個人的出生日期,假設該日期存儲在單元格A2中。
1. 使用DATEDIF函數計算年齡
首先,我們可以使用DATEDIF函數計算從出生日期到當前日期之間的天數:
DATEDIF(A2, TODAY(), "d")
上述公式中,A2是出生日期的單元格引用,TODAY()為當前日期。最后一個參數"d"指定了我們想要計算的時間單位為天。
接下來,我們可以將計算出的天數除以365或366(考慮閏年),以得到年齡的大致值。例如,如果我們得到的天數為365,意味著該人剛好滿一歲。
DATEDIF(A2, TODAY(), "d") / 365
這樣就可以得到一個大致的年齡值,但是不精確到日。
2. 使用DATEDIF函數和MOD函數計算精確年齡
要將年齡精確到日,我們可以結合使用DATEDIF函數和MOD函數。MOD函數用于獲取兩個日期之間的余數,即天數的差異。
DATEDIF(A2, TODAY(), "y") "歲" DATEDIF(A2, TODAY(), "ym") "個月" DATEDIF(A2, TODAY(), "md") "天"
上述公式中,"y"代表年份,"ym"代表年月,"md"代表月天。通過將這三個部分連接在一起,我們可以得到一個精確到日的年齡值。
所以,使用Excel的日期函數,我們可以快速而準確地計算出一個人的年齡,無需手動計算或者依賴其他工具。這對于人事管理、數據分析等領域非常實用。希望本文對您有所幫助!